




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、,SQL Server Consolidation at Microsoft,Published: March 2009,Microsoft IT operates thousands of SQLServer instances. Most reside on dedicated physical hardware and are typically underutilized. MicrosoftIT wanted to reduce expenses by providing a utility for SQLServer instances.,Solution Overview,Bus
2、iness Challenge,Solution,Results/Benefits,MicrosoftIT produced the SQLUtility to improve SQLServer manageability through host consolidation, virtualization, and standardization.,Reduced operating and capital expenses Improved business continuity, scalability, and availability Improved environmental
3、sustainability Standardized build for SQLServer instances,Products and Technology,Windows Server 2008 SQL Server 2005 SQL Server 2008 Hyper-V SQL Utility Compute Utility Storage Utility,Positive Effects of Consolidation,Utilities in Microsoft IT,Identification of Underutilized Servers,Consolidation
4、Approaches,Three primary approaches Host consolidation Instance consolidation Database consolidation Microsoft IT used host consolidation to reduce risks such as SLA conflicts and shared resources,Virtualization Platform: WSRM vs. Hyper-V,Approach to resource management is an important decision Micr
5、osoft IT evaluated WSRM and Hyper-V and ultimately chose Hyper-V Microsoft IT uses Hyper-V to manage processor and memory use on host and guest partitions,Windows System Resource Manager,Hyper-V,Implementation of SQL Utility,Microsoft IT is implementing the SQL Utility in phases SQL Server hosts sch
6、eduled for EOL replacement are the first candidates for consolidation SQL Utility service is consumption based Selected implementation provides always-on high availability with flexible business continuity and disaster recovery,SQL Utility Architecture,Service Offerings,Service Offerings: Determinin
7、g the Configuration,Service Offerings: Hyper-V and the SDLC,Identification of Candidates for Migration,Microsoft IT uses several criteria to qualify candidate SQLServer instances for migration RightSizing data and capacity management guidance will guide server provisioning Monitoring ensures that a
8、new SQL Server instance does not adversely affect performance Host count and reduction in rack space and power consumption will determine success of phase 1,Attributes of System Quality,Availability and Business Continuity,SQL Utility deployment focuses on non-clustered SQL Server instances at this
9、time Microsoft ITidentified requirements and recommendations cover: Uptime General clustering Network adapter and network Cluster service Quorum,Availability and Business Continuity: Best Practices,Configure at least two of the cluster networks for internal cluster communication Design cluster netwo
10、rks to fail independently Do not connect multiple adapters on one node to the same network when not using teaming Ensure that two or more independent networks connect the nodes of a cluster Use identical network adapters,Availability and Business Continuity: Metrics,Availability and Business Continu
11、ity: Scorecard,Environmental Sustainability,Migrating SQL Server instances to the SQL Utility service decreases power consumption New servers may decrease data-center cooling needs Ability of new servers to host several instances of SQL Server reduces the data centers footprint Purchasing fewer phys
12、ical servers will mean less hardware to recycle,Manageability,Microsoft IT requirements for manageability: Take advantage of current database administration and automation tools Identify and develop operational processes for onboarding, upgrades, and failover Support previous, current, and future SQ
13、LServer versions Support the previous, current, and future IPAK Support CSSsupported environments,Provisioning,SQLUtility will eventually reduce the number of manual steps needed to deploy new SQLServer instances Virtual Machine Manager library will enable developers, testers, and production support
14、 teams to provide a consistent experience throughout the SDLC,Performance,Primary performance requirement for SQLUtility is providing equal or greater CUs, memory, and disk performance as the SQLServer instance used on its previous host Other requirements pertain to database and applications, read a
15、nd write operations, memory, and processor MicrosoftIT uses several performance-related guidelines for consolidation,Performance: Storage,Performance: Comparison of I/Os per Second,Performance: Latency Comparison,Performance: Stock Trading System Workload,Performance: Summary for Guest Configuration
16、s,Predictability and Repeatability,Application deployment and SDLCs frequently introduce risk of inconsistencies between environments SQL Utility will reduce or eliminate these inconsistencies by creating standard builds,Reliability,Overconsumption of shared resources in a consolidated environment w
17、as a key concern of SQL Server users Another concern was propagation of changes through the consolidated environment Operating system isolation in Hyper-V alleviated these concerns Primary reliability metric for SQL Utility is MTBF,Scalability,Scalability requirements of SQL Utility pertain to: CUs,
18、 memory, network bandwidth, and I/O throughput Storage performance Flexibility in moving an instance to a new host Adjustments to resource allocation Scalability through virtualization technology is much easier than with dedicated physical server hardware,Security,Hyper-V method of partitioning enab
19、les the traditional Microsoft IT security model to continue for production support teams Requirements for security are based largely on the policies laid out for MicrosoftIT deployments, including ACE policies,Monitoring,SQL Utility must meet requirements for service monitoring and control Monitorin
20、g requirements remain primarily the same as in a non-consolidated environment Monitoring services for the non-consolidated environment will continue to be used for the SQLUtility service,Supportability,SQLUtility will deploy only supported configurations of SQLServer Microsoft IT will anticipate fut
21、ure supported configuration scenarios and refine the service,Conclusion,SQL Utility is helping Microsoft IT reduce the number of data-center servers SQL Utility improves manageability SQLUtility provides and enhances business continuity, availability, scalability, and sustainability Project has met
22、early goals and will provide increasing value,For More Information,“Running SQL Server 2008 in a Hyper-V EnvironmentBest Practices and Performance Recommendations” SQLIO Disk Subsystem Benchmark Tool “Green IT in Practice: SQLServer Consolidation in MicrosoftIT” Standard Performance Evaluation Corporation ,For More Information,“SQL Server Automation Scripts” “Virtualization Strategy Provides Tools, Processes, and Compliance Capabilities to Enhance Business Support and Drive Adoption” “Identifying Server Candidates for Virtualization” Virtu
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 都匀三中小升初数学试卷
- 奉化今年高考数学试卷
- 2025年05月四川成都市青白江区妇幼保健院第二季面向社会招聘编外人员8人笔试历年专业考点(难、易错点)附带答案详解
- 2025年云南迪庆州德钦县人民医院招聘编外影像技术专业人员(1人)笔试历年专业考点(难、易错点)附带答案详解
- 防暑知识培训课件
- 2025至2030纯净水零售行业发展趋势分析与未来投资战略咨询研究报告
- 湖南兴湘科技创新有限公司招聘笔试真题2024
- 2024年衡水深州市市直机关选调笔试真题
- 港北区分班考数学试卷
- 福州名校联考数学试卷
- 二年级数学必练100题
- 网络带宽使用证明
- 民众生活中的民俗学智慧树知到期末考试答案章节答案2024年湖南师范大学
- 麻醉中的呼气末正压调节技巧
- 组织学与胚胎学(南方医科大学)智慧树知到期末考试答案章节答案2024年南方医科大学
- 2020年云南省曲靖市富源县中小学、幼儿园教师进城考试真题库及答案
- 教师专业发展智慧树知到期末考试答案2024年
- 2024年03月广东省韶关市法院2024年招考31名劳动合同制审判辅助人员笔试历年(2016-2023年)真题荟萃带答案解析
- 师承指导老师临床经验总结
- 抛光简介介绍
- 热射病预防与急救
评论
0/150
提交评论